In introducing the central mystery of the Sphinx, Anyextee focuses on the work of West and Dr. Robert Schoch, as it was they who definitively proved that the monument is far more ancient than academia claims. This material naturally leads into the great mystery of the Hall of Records, which West, Schoch and Thomas Dobecki discovered, essentially by accident, as they were scanning the subsurface strata in the Sphinx courtyard. As the renowned psychic, Edgar Cayce, claimed, beneath the front paws of the Sphinx lies a hidden entrance to a sealed Hall of Records, containing historic archives and relics of Atlantis. THIS, simply put, is the great mystery of the Sphinx; first, that it is far older than we’ve been told and second, that it is an entrance to a secret place, which is, perhaps, connected to other secret places… When West’s team scanned the ground, they discovered a ‘rectangular cavity’ directly below the front paws, as Cayce had predicted. No one has ever reported entering this chamber and many researchers have faced great difficulty even being able to get close.

In 2019, I joined Dr. Robert Schoch in the Sphinx Temple, which he had only been inside once before, during the filming of Mystery of the Sphinx. He can be seen here happily collecting photographic evidence of incredible stonemasonry. Many of these blocks were quarried directly out of the Sphinx Courtyard as the sculpture’s body was carved down into bedrock, so we can tell that this temple was built contemporary with the carving of the Sphinx. This in itself tells us a great deal.
